Transaction 124e17c6674924a74af3043b9eead30442a979c0441e9d7721757bac260b5f94

1 Input
2 Outputs
  • 124e17c6674924a74af3043b9eead30442a979c0441e9d7721757bac260b5f94:0
  • value  165650585
    address  1QBkvmTiHe2Uy2bTJ8d1XYgUtov1JchUXG
  • 124e17c6674924a74af3043b9eead30442a979c0441e9d7721757bac260b5f94:1
  • value  26213569
    address  16VGZ1HcqzXSa9Ef7ad6KxZRVmpbLKjaP7